Experiment with different shapes and sizes. You can make smaller individual breads or a larger loaf, depending on your preference.
Store any leftovers in an airtight container. The bread can be reheated in a skillet or toaster for a fresh taste.
Practice makes perfect. The more you make this bread, the more you’ll get a feel for the right consistency and cooking time.
